ICD-10 Medical Coding CertificateICD-10 is an upgraded diagnostic and procedural medical coding system that, by law, must be implemented throughout the healthcare industry by October 1, 2015. This new coding system is radi-cally different from the version currently in use. Gain comprehensive training in diagnostic and procedural coding, using the ICD-10-CM (diagnostic) and ICD-10-PCS (procedural) coding manuals. This course includes detailed instructions for using the coding manuals, understand-ing the coding guidelines, and accurately applying the ICD-10 coding steps. Learn about the impact of the coding changes on medical coders, healthcare staff, physi-cians, software systems, documentation, and information technology. There are more than 40 quizzes and exams for diag-noses and procedures by body system to test your knowledge and understanding. All materials included.

TESOL Linguistics covers immersion in the elements constituting language: phonol-ogy, morphology, phonetics, syntax, semantics, pragmatics, sociolinguistics, psycholin-guistics, and how language is learned across age levels.
Research, discussions, group projects and reports are all part of the coursework in the Linguistics class for TESOL.

Lean Mastery Certificate Lean enterprise is a process designed to bring about rapid improvements to an organization's performance through an overhaul of the value stream. It focuses on value, waste elimination, and continuous incremental improve-ment. Lean uses specific concepts that are intended to provide excel-lent quality products, delivered on time, at the lowest total cost, and only on the specific demand of the customer. This course con-tains clear, concise information on transforming an enterprise to lean. The program includes examples, photographs, graphics, quizzes, progress tests, case studies, and many interactive features that pro-vide tips, "try this" exercises, and in-depth information.

Six Sigma Green Belt CertificateSix Sigma is a quality improvement methodology structured to reduce product or service failure rates. This online program encompasses all aspects of a business, including management, service delivery, design, production and customer satisfaction. Six Sigma is one of the highest standards for companies and individuals to achieve. Once you’ve completed this program, you’ll be ready to successfully participate in a Six Sigma team. Six Sigma Black Belt CertificateThe Black Belt training program inte-grates online learning with hands-on data analysis. The course material provides an in-depth look at the DMAIC problem-solving methodology, as well as deployment and project development approaches. The course flow follows the DMAIC methodology, with the appropri-ate tools and concepts taught at each stage of project deployment. Since software will be used for data analysis, the course material concentrates on the application and use of the tools, rather than on detailed derivation of the statisti-cal methods.
